COLOMBO (News 1st) - Doctors of the Karapitiya Hospital convened a media briefing today (May 26) to highlight the issues which have arisen in controlling an outbreak of viral flu in the Southern Province. According to the President of the GMOA Karapitiya Branch, Specialist Dr.Janath Liyanage, the cases are most severe among children under 2 years old. He stated that the Karapitiya Hospital is the only hospital in the entire province with a Paediatric Intensive Care Unit,  and that there are just two doctors with specialist training for this purpose for the entire Southern Province. He added that there are just seven beds in this Intensive Care Unit and in light of this situation, children whose conditions are critical are being treated at adult ICUs.Dr. Liyanage requested the government to treat this matter as a priority and provide the necessary equipment and resources as quickly as possible.
